Issue 3222 of Asha'b Newspaper, 7 March 1983

Printed in Arabic, this includes issue number 3222 of Asha'b Newspaper issued on 7 March 1983, which is a 6-paged daily, political and illustrated newspaper, issued by the Asha'b al-Arabeyyah Press at Sheikh Jarrah in Jerusalem. The issue cost 8 shekels and included a collection of statements, announcements, advertisements and political and sports news including:  - Yasser Arafat participates in the Seventh Conference of the Non-Aligned Movement. - The suspension of international contacts for the exchange of prisoners between the Palestine Liberation Organization (PLO) and Israel. - The colonists of "Kiryat Arba" want the trial of Mustafa an-Natsheh, the mayor of Hebron. - Jimmy Carter, former US president, meets with officials of the PLO. - Hosni Mubarak, President of Egypt, attacks the PLO and threatens to take action against the Palestinians. - “An investigation into the massacre,” the second part, about the Sabra and Shatila massacre, written by the Israeli journalist Amnon Kapeluk. - "The Palestinian position on the settlement", an article by Faisal Hourani. - "The Verbatim Text of the Kahan Committee Report on the Massacres of the Sabra and Shatila Palestinian Refugee Camps" Episode 20 from the Israeli newspaper Yedioth Ahronoth. - Celebrations and festivals in the occupied West Bank to celebrate International Women's Day. - Electing a new administrative body for the Jerusalem Laundry Workers Syndicate. - The world's poor are trying to formulate a formula for dealing with the rich North in New Delhi. - Local sports variety, prepared by Ibrahim Ghaith. - “We are more united than before,” according to the Israeli newspaper Yedioth Ahronoth, by Amnon Kabiluk.
